Course content
Lectures: 1) Introduction to transfusion and blood derivatives 2) Introduction to parenteral nutrition 3) Introduction to surgical problems 4) Introduction to endoscopic examination and puncture 5) Introduction to osteology 6) Thanatological Nursing Care Exercises: 1) Nursing process when applying blood transfusion products and blood derivatives. 2) Nursing process in the application of parenteral nutrition. 3) Nursing process in P / K with surgical disease. Preoperative and postoperative care, wound care, surgeons, surgical instrumentarium, small surgical procedures. 4) Nursing process at P / K with drain. 5) Nursing process at P / K with puncture examination. 6) Nursing process in P / K with endoscopic examination. 7) Nursing process at P / K with stoma. 6) Thanatological Nursing Care.

Learning outcomes
The subject included as a compulsory subject of the study branch forms a basis of professional abilities. The instruction is both theoretical and practical. It enables to acquire basic manual skill, confidence of safe and well executed medical performance on patients. Well executed performance respects individual needs of patients, mainly their need of comfort, respect, certainty and safety.
